Text

An individual may employ private counsel to represent the individual in proceedings authorized by this article.

Free access — add to your briefcase to read the full text and ask questions with AI

Legislative History

HISTORY: 2008 Act No. 361, SECTION 2; 2015 Act No. 33 (S.500), SECTION 1, eff June 1, 2015. Effect of Amendment 2015 Act No. 33, SECTION 1, reenacted this section with no change.
